Content Engine
Build platform-native content without flattening the author's real voice into platform slop.
When to Activate
- writing X posts or threads
- drafting LinkedIn posts or launch updates
- scripting short-form video or YouTube explainers
- repurposing articles, podcasts, demos, docs, or internal notes into public content
- building a launch sequence or ongoing content system around a product, insight, or narrative
Non-Negotiables
- Start from source material, not generic post formulas.
- Adapt the format for the platform, not the persona.
- One post should carry one actual claim.
- Specificity beats adjectives.
- No engagement bait unless the user explicitly asks for it.
Source-First Workflow
Before drafting, identify the source set:
- published articles
- notes or internal memos
- product demos
- docs or changelogs
- transcripts
- screenshots
- prior posts from the same author
If the user wants a specific voice, build a voice profile from real examples before writing.
Use brand-voice as the canonical workflow when voice consistency matters across more than one output.
Voice Handling
brand-voice is the canonical voice layer.
Run it first when:
- there are multiple downstream outputs
- the user explicitly cares about writing style
- the content is launch, outreach, or reputation-sensitive
Reuse the resulting VOICE PROFILE here instead of rebuilding a second voice model.
If the user wants Affaan / ECC voice specifically, still treat brand-voice as the source of truth and feed it the best live or source-derived material available.
Hard Bans
Delete and rewrite any of these:
- "In today's rapidly evolving landscape"
- "game-changer", "revolutionary", "cutting-edge"
- "here's why this matters" unless it is followed immediately by something concrete
- ending with a LinkedIn-style question just to farm replies
- forced casualness on LinkedIn
- fake engagement padding that was not present in the source material
